GEORGIA, FORSYTH COUNTY.
TO THE SUPERIOR COURT OF
SAID COUNTY.
«The petition of LOY H. BARi-
NETT, EIRON L. BARNETT and
JAMES L. BARNETT, whose ad
dress is Cumming, Georgia, here
inafter referred to as petitioners,
respectfully shows:
1.
Petitioners desire for themselves,
their associates and successors to
be incorporated under the name
and style of
4 ‘BARNETT & SONS FEED &
POULTRY CO. ”
2.
The object of said corporation is
pecuniary gain and profit.
3.
The general nature of the busi
ness of the corporation shall be to
engage in the business of growing
and marketing broilers, including
buying and selling of feeds, poul
try, supplies and equipment, to
gether with hatching, breeding and
all other type work incident to the
producing, marketing and process
ing for the poultry business; peti
tioners also desire to purchase, ac
quire, hold, sell and convey prop
erty both real and personal of
every kind and character incident
to operation of said business.
4.
There will be outstanding only
common stock of par value of
SIOO.OO per share, which shall have
all the voting rights but no pre
emptive rights, the amount of com
mon stock outstanding shall not be
less than $4500.00 but shall not ex
ceed $50,000.00. The stock holders
may, without charter amendment,
by a two-thirds majority vote at
any meeting of the stockholders
duly called for such purpose, in
crease or decrease the number of
outstanding shares of stock be
tween the limits herein specified.
5.
The amount of capital stock with
which the corporation shall begin
(business shall not be less than
$1,000.00 which may be represented
either by cash or property with a
fair market value of that amount.
6.
The corporation shall have an
existence for a period of thirty-five
(35) years with the privilege of
renewal and its principal office
shall be in Forsyth County, Geor
gia, but it shall have the privilege
of establishing branch offices and
places of business elsewhere with
in this State.
7.
Petitioners desire that By-laws
of the corporation be adopted
which By-laws shall provide for
the officers of the corporation, the
manner of their selection, and
such other rules appropriate to
By-laws which have for their pur
pose the control and management
of the corporation, including pro
visions whereby the By-laws may
be amended.
Your petitioners herewith exhibit
a certificate of the Secretary of
the State of Georgia as required by
Section 22—1803, Code of Georgia,
19-33, as amended.
WHEREFORE, petitioners pray
to be incorporated under the name
and style of “BARNETT & SONS
FEED & POULTRY CO.” afore
said with all the rights, powers,
privileges and immunities herein
set forth and such additional rights
powers and privileges as may be
inherent in or allowed to like cor
porations under the laws of the
State of Georgia as they now exist
or may hereafter exist.
JESS H. WATSON,
Attorney for Petitioners.
